Automated Video Analysis for Technique Improvement
1. Objective Definition
1.1 Identify Key Performance Indicators (KPIs)
Determine the specific techniques and skills to be analyzed, such as shooting accuracy, footwork, or stroke mechanics.
1.2 Set Improvement Goals
Establish measurable goals for athlete performance enhancement based on the identified KPIs.
2. Video Capture
2.1 Equipment Setup
Utilize high-definition cameras or drones to capture training sessions and competitions from multiple angles.
2.2 Data Collection
Record videos of athletes during practice and competitive events, ensuring consistent lighting and framing for optimal analysis.
3. Video Upload
3.1 Data Transfer
Upload captured videos to a cloud-based platform for accessibility and processing.
3.2 File Management
Organize video files by athlete, date, and type of analysis for efficient retrieval.
4. AI-driven Analysis
4.1 AI Tool Selection
Choose appropriate AI-driven tools such as:
- Hudl: Offers video analysis and performance insights for various sports.
- Kinovea: A free tool for motion analysis that allows coaches to dissect athlete movements frame by frame.
- Ubersense: Provides instant feedback through video analysis and performance tracking.
4.2 Automated Technique Assessment
Utilize AI algorithms to analyze the video footage, focusing on biomechanics, movement patterns, and adherence to optimal techniques.
4.3 Data Interpretation
Generate reports that summarize the analysis results, highlighting areas for improvement and strengths.
5. Feedback Loop
5.1 Coach Review
Coaches review the AI-generated reports and video highlights to provide personalized feedback to athletes.
5.2 Athlete Engagement
Engage athletes in discussions regarding their performance, fostering an understanding of the analysis and improvement strategies.
6. Training Adjustments
6.1 Tailored Training Plans
Modify training regimens based on analysis findings, focusing on specific skills that require improvement.
6.2 Continuous Monitoring
Implement ongoing video analysis to track progress and adapt training plans as necessary.
7. Performance Evaluation
7.1 Re-assessment
Conduct follow-up video analysis after a set training period to evaluate improvements against initial KPIs.
7.2 Outcome Reporting
Prepare comprehensive reports detailing progress, areas of success, and further recommendations for continued development.
8. Iterative Process
8.1 Continuous Improvement Cycle
Repeat the workflow regularly to ensure athletes are consistently improving and adapting to new techniques and strategies.
8.2 Integration of New Technologies
Stay updated on advancements in AI tools and methodologies to enhance the analysis process and athlete development.
